Style Creator Changing the Rhythmic Feel (GROOVE) The explanation here applies when you select the GROOVE tab in step 4 of "Basic Operation for Editing Styles" (page 119). 1 Press the [A]/[B] button to select the edit menu (page 121). 1 3 4 2 2 Use the [1π†]-[8π†] buttons to edit the data. For details on editable parameters, see page 121. 3 Press the [D] (EXECUTE) button to actually enter the edits for each display. After the operation is completed, you can execute the edition and this button changes to "UNDO," letting you restore the original data if you're not satisfied with the Groove or Dynamics results. The Undo function only has one level; only the previous operation can be undone. 4 Press the [I] (SAVE) button to call up the Style Selection display to CAUTION save your data. The edited Style will be lost if Save the data in the Style Selection display (page 70). you change to another Style or you turn the power off without executing the Save operation (page 70).
